BlackBerry Classic Q20: Larger Screen, Larger Battery And Larger SD Card, Obvious Difference Between BlackBerry Q10 Is The Re-Introduction Of A Trackpad
"BlackBerry" fanatics, you have a new device to get crazy with! It is announced that the "BlackBerry Classic Q20" is the upcoming device that will amaze you. Although the device is expected to only be available starting November, there are specs and image leaks surfacing around the web. At the same time, there are lots of questions surrounding it.
Can this device exceed the success and popularity of its successors? Are its specs enough to surprise the eager consumers? Does the "BlackBerry Classic Q20" have the high quality features that will take its user's mobile experience more exciting?
Even if you can already find some details about the "BlackBerry Classic Q20", still, all of those are unofficial for now. The new design might cause some tickle to those who love curvy and bold. It appears that the "BlackBerry Classic" will have almost the same specs with the "BlackBerry Q10", basing on the allegedly leaked photos. According to the gossips and some predictions, the most obvious difference between the two BlackBerry phones is the re-introduction of a trackpad. Also, it is expected by many that the "BlackBerry Classic Q20" will have a larger screen, larger battery and possibly larger SD card amounts.
IB times reported that, the "BlackBerry Classic Q20" is actually the fourth instalment of BlackBerry's Smartphone. During the MWC 2014, it was revealed and the BlackBerry CEO John Chen has shown the handset.
If you would try to search the internet today, there are numerous leaked photos and specifications of the device. According to Air Herald, you can see that the new device will have a QWERTY keypad and looks sort of like the old "BlackBerry Curve" models.
The manufacturer has spoken and declared that the new handset is made of premium materials. On the right part, located are the two volume controllers and at the bottom part are the dual speakers.
It is also very exciting that it weighs 178 g with a measurement of 131 x 72.4 x 10.2 mm. The screen size is expected to be 3.46-inch with 720 x 720 pixels. This will also house an 8 MP camera on its rear side capable of recording full HD videos.
